LYNCHBURG, Va. — Bert Dodson Jr., owner of Dodson Pest Control, Lynchburg, Va., announced he is running for a newly created and open Virginia state Senate seat (22nd district). Dodson previously served for 12 years on the Lynchburg City Council.
“I am running because I strongly believe that we need more people with a business background in the State Senate,” Dodson said in a statement. “I am going to use my business experience to help create and maintain good jobs for all of our citizens.”
Dodson is running as a Democrat. The 22nd district includes Lynchburg and the counties of Amherst, Appomattox, Buckingham, Cumberland, Fluvanna, Goochland and Prince Edward, along with part of Louisa County.
